James Franklin to be named Penn State head coach
Vanderbilt coach James Franklin is expected to become the new head coach at Penn State, according to multiple reports.
Franklin won 24 games in the past three years at Vanderbilt
Vanderbilt won bowl games each of the past two seasons.
Franklin, 41, is a former University of Maryland assistant who was being pursued for NFL head coaching interviews, including the Washington Redskins and Cleveland Browns.
Now, he'll remain in the college ranks and take over for Bill O'Brien, who left Penn State to become the Houston Texans' new head coach.
